The board shall, pursuant to the Wyoming
Administrative Procedure Act, promulgate and enforce all rules
and regulations.
The board shall have six (6) members, to be appointed
by the governor, with the advice and consent of the senate. The
state geologist shall be the seventh and a permanent member of
the board. Insofar as possible, the board shall proportionally
represent the various geologic subdisciplines practicing in the
state.
Except for the state geologist, members of the board
shall hold office for staggered terms of four (4) years. Each
appointed member shall be limited to serving on the board for
eight (8) consecutive years. A member may be reappointed after a
four (4) year absence. Each member shall hold office until his
successor is appointed and has been qualified.
